如何利用AI语音开发构建智能语音内容分析系统?

随着人工智能技术的不断发展,AI语音技术在各行各业中的应用越来越广泛。利用AI语音开发构建智能语音内容分析系统,不仅可以提高工作效率,还能为企业带来巨大的经济效益。本文将讲述一个关于如何利用AI语音开发构建智能语音内容分析系统的故事。

故事的主人公名叫张明,是一家知名互联网公司的产品经理。张明所在的公司主要从事在线教育业务,旗下有一款热门的在线教育平台。然而,随着用户数量的不断增长,公司面临着一个棘手的问题:如何高效地对海量的语音数据进行处理和分析,以了解用户需求,优化课程内容。

为了解决这一问题,张明决定利用AI语音技术开发一款智能语音内容分析系统。以下是张明构建智能语音内容分析系统的过程:

一、需求分析

在项目启动之初,张明首先对公司的业务需求进行了深入分析。他发现,智能语音内容分析系统需要具备以下功能:

  1. 语音识别:将用户上传的语音数据转换为文本格式,以便后续分析。

  2. 语义理解:对转换后的文本进行语义分析,提取关键信息。

  3. 情感分析:分析用户在语音中的情感倾向,如积极、消极等。

  4. 用户画像:根据用户语音数据,构建用户画像,了解用户需求和兴趣。

  5. 数据可视化:将分析结果以图表形式展示,方便决策者了解用户需求。

二、技术选型

在明确需求后,张明开始着手选择合适的技术方案。经过调研和比较,他决定采用以下技术:

  1. 语音识别:选用科大讯飞、百度语音等成熟的语音识别API。

  2. 语义理解:采用自然语言处理(NLP)技术,如LSTM、BERT等。

  3. 情感分析:选用情感分析模型,如TextBlob、VADER等。

  4. 用户画像:采用聚类算法,如K-means、DBSCAN等。

  5. 数据可视化:使用ECharts、D3.js等前端图表库。

三、系统开发

在技术选型完成后,张明开始组织团队进行系统开发。以下是系统开发的主要步骤:

  1. 确定技术架构:采用微服务架构,将系统划分为多个独立的服务模块。

  2. 数据采集与处理:从在线教育平台获取用户语音数据,进行预处理,如去噪、分帧等。

  3. 语音识别:调用语音识别API,将语音数据转换为文本格式。

  4. 语义理解与情感分析:对文本进行语义分析和情感分析,提取关键信息。

  5. 用户画像构建:根据分析结果,构建用户画像。

  6. 数据可视化:将分析结果以图表形式展示。

四、系统部署与优化

系统开发完成后,张明组织团队进行系统部署。以下是系统部署与优化过程中的关键步骤:

  1. 部署环境:选择合适的云服务器,如阿里云、腾讯云等。

  2. 数据存储:采用分布式数据库,如MongoDB、Redis等。

  3. 服务监控:使用Prometheus、Grafana等工具监控系统性能。

  4. 优化策略:根据系统运行情况,不断调整优化策略,提高系统稳定性。

五、成果与应用

经过几个月的努力,张明带领团队成功构建了智能语音内容分析系统。该系统上线后,取得了以下成果:

  1. 提高了语音数据处理的效率,降低了人力成本。

  2. 优化了课程内容,提升了用户体验。

  3. 为公司决策提供了有力支持,助力业务发展。

总之,利用AI语音开发构建智能语音内容分析系统,对于企业来说具有重要意义。通过这个故事,我们可以了解到,只要深入分析需求,选择合适的技术方案,并不断优化系统,就能构建出高效、稳定的智能语音内容分析系统,为企业带来实实在在的利益。

猜你喜欢:智能对话